Book cover of Psychology for Screenwriters
by William Indick
Language: English
Release Date: September 25, 2004

Screenwriters must understand human behavior to make their stories come alive. This book clearly describes theories of personality and psychoanalysis with simple guidelines, thought provoking exercises, vivid film images and hundreds of examples from classic movies.
